    Gutsy Raiders go down in Belmore thriller

    Canberra Raiders gave effort but lost to Canterbury Bulldogs in Josh Papalii's 300th game.

    The Canberra Times

    You couldn't fault the Canberra Raiders' effort, but given it was Josh Papali'i's 300th NRL game that was never going to be a factor.

    But it wasn't quite enough in a thriller at a sold-out Belmore, with the Canterbury Bulldogs getting up 22-18 on Sunday.

    It was the biggest crowd at the venue since 2015.

    'These kids that look up to me': The inspiration driving Papali'i to NRL greatness

    Canberra Raiders great honors inspirations in his 14-year NRL career, displaying photos in locker.

    The Canberra Times

    They're the inspirations driving a Canberra Raiders great to join an elite group.

    Some of them are sick, some of them are no longer with us and some of them are just kids he's met along the way in his 14-year NRL career.

    Regardless of who they are, every week their pictures are lovingly put up in Josh Papali'i's change-room locker - so many times some of them are starting to fray around the edges.

    Untold story of how milestone man Papalii almost became a Rabbitoh

    Josh Papalii almost joined South Sydney Rabbitohs before playing 300 NRL games for Canberra Raiders.

    The Sydney Morning Herald

    Josh Papalii famously backflipped on a move to Parramatta in 2013, but what is not known is how the latest member of the NRL's 300 club almost became a South Sydney Rabbitoh.

    The front-rower will celebrate the special milestone when he leads the way for the Canberra Raiders against the Bulldogs at a packed Belmore Sportsground on Sunday afternoon.

    It is an excellent achievement for Papalii, considering he has spent his entire career at the one club, and the position he plays.
